10 U.S.C. § 627 — Failure of selection for promotion

An eligible officer who is considered but not chosen by a selection board is treated as having failed selection for promotion.
An officer* in a grade* below the grade of colonel or, in the case of an officer of the Navy, captain who is in or above the promotion zone* established for his grade and competitive category under section 623 of this title and is considered but not selected for promotion by a selection board convened under section 611(a) of this title shall be considered to have failed of selection for promotion.
Source credit: (Added Pub. L. 96–513, title I, § 105, Dec. 12, 1980, 94 Stat. 2859.)
